Hanging Valley Emergency Shelter
Hanging Valley Emergency Shelter is a DOC-managed backcountry shelter on the Kepler Track in Fiordland National Park, placed on the exposed ridgeline between Luxmore Hut and Iris Burn Hut. It’s there for wind- and weather-protection when you’re crossing this high-alpine section and visibility turns poor.
The shelter is basic but includes toilets and a reliable water source, with use focused on stopping for safety and rest in severe alpine conditions. It sits around 1,390 m on the track, and the Kepler approach passes the Hanging Valley Emergency Shelter between a named “Shelter and Toilet” point and the later drop toward Iris Burn.
